베스트셀러 앨범 목록
List of best-selling albums이것은 세계에서 가장 많이 팔린 음반 목록이다. 리스트에 등장하기 위해서는 이 수치가 믿을 만한 출처에 의해 출판되었고 앨범은 적어도 2천만 장이 팔렸어야 한다. 이 목록은 스튜디오 앨범, 연장된 연극, 최고의 히트곡, 컴필레이션, 다양한 아티스트, 사운드트랙, 리믹스를 포함한 모든 종류의 앨범을 포함할 수 있다. 주어진 수치는 중고 앨범의 재판매를 고려하지 않는다.[a]
이 목록에 포함된 모든 앨범은 인증된 복사본에서 최소한 30%의 지지를 받고 있다. 필요한 인증 판매량은 앨범이 새로워질수록 증가하기 때문에 1975년 이전에 발매된 앨범들은 인증된 복사본에서 최소한 30%의 지지를 받을 것으로 예상된다. 그러나 21, Come Away with Me와 같은 새로운 앨범들은 인증된 복사본에서 최소한 70%의 지지를 받을 것으로 예상된다. 인증된 복사본은 지역 음악 산업 협회의 온라인 데이터베이스에서 소싱된다. 사운드 오브 뮤직, 인-아-가다-다-비다, 평행선, 스피릿 해빙 블라이드, 프라이빗 댄서, 자넷, 믿음, 볼로 타라라, 휴먼 클레이, 세탁 서비스, 백 투 블랙 등 그렇지 않으면 리스트에 오를 앨범이 포함되지 않은 이유다.
미국 및 캐나다 인증기관(RIAA, Music Canada)이 사용하는 방법론의 결과, 멀티 디스크 세트의 각 디스크는 인증을 위한 하나의 단위로 계산되어, 목록에 있는 많은 더블 앨범(예: 핑크 플로이드의 더 월(The Wall), 비틀즈의 비틀즈(Beatles) 등)이 두 배수로 인증을 받았다. 거기서 팔린 부수의 수 이러한 앨범에는 표시된 (디스크가 아닌) 사본 수에 대한 인증이 있다. 반대로 Saturday Night Fever 사운드 트랙과 같이 콤팩트 디스크 하나에 맞는 더블 앨범에 대한 미국 인증 수준은 실제 판매된 앨범 수를 반영한다. 2016년 RIAA는 인증 목적의 앨범 등가 단위 개념에 따른 트랙 판매와 앨범 판매 외에 스트리밍을 포함시켰고, 따라서 인증은 더 이상 출하량만을 반영하지 않는다.[1][2] 예를 들어 2018년 8월 이글스의 The Greatest Hits(1971–1975) 인증 업데이트에서 새로운 기준에 따라 38× Platinum(2006년 이전 29× Platinum 인증보다 증가)을 인증받아, 당시 미국에서 가장 높은 인증을 받은 앨범이 되었다.[3]
전 세계적으로 7000만 장이 팔린 것으로 추정되는 마이클 잭슨의 스릴러 앨범이 베스트셀러다.[4][5][6] 스릴러의 판매 추정치는 1억2000만부까지 올랐지만, 이 판매 수치는 믿을 수 없다.[7] 잭슨 역시 현재 5장으로 가장 많은 앨범을 보유하고 있으며 셀린 디온은 4장, 비틀즈, 핑크 플로이드, 마돈나, 휘트니 휴스턴은 각각 3장을 보유하고 있다.
그룹화는 서로 다른 판매 벤치마크를 기반으로 하며, 가장 높은 판매량은 최소 4,000만 부, 가장 낮은 판매량은 2,000만-2900만 부를 청구하는 것이다. 앨범은 판매된 앨범의 수순에 따라, 그 이후에 그 가수의 이름으로 나열된다. 시장의 표 내 주문은 각 시장에서 판매되는 콤팩트 디스크의 수를 기준으로 하며, 상단에서 가장 큰 시장이며 하단에서 가장 작은 시장이기도 하다.[8]

전 세계 연도별 베스트셀러 앨범
전 세계에서 연도별 베스트셀러 앨범 차트는 2001년부터 매년 국제음반산업연맹이 집계하고 있다. 이 차트는 디지털 음악 보고서와 숫자로 된 녹음 산업이라는 두 개의 연례 보고서에 발표된다. 디지털 음악 보고서와 숫자의 음반 산업 모두 2016년 글로벌 음악 보고서로 대체되었다.[191]
판매되는 유닛에는 물리적 복사본과 디지털 다운로드가 포함된다.
